1. Offer to Babysit for Friends and Family

Babysitting can be one of the absolute easiest ways for a mom to earn money fast from home. People are ALWAYS looking for reliable babysitters, and they are willing to pay a pretty penny to someone they can trust.

If you’re looking for a way to earn money without any start up costs, and need cash NOW, then go and post on facebook that you’re opening up your home for babysitting.

You can write something like this:

Hey friends! I am looking to start offering babysitting in my home on XYZ days at XYZ times. I’m wondering if there would be anyone on my friends list that is looking for some extra childcare, maybe for a date night or for a mommy’s day out.

My rates are reasonable and my home comes baby-proof and with built-in playmates.

If you’re looking for a reliable friend to trust your babies to for day or even an evening, please DM me! Feel free to share or tag a mommy-in-need.

Easy peasy. Your rates should depend on your area. Look on care.com and put in your area to see what babysitters around you are charging. I’m located in Dallas, TX and babysitting runs anywhere form $15-25/hr depending on experience. 

Make sure you look up your area so that you can make sure you’re fairly charging. You can offer discounts to friends and family, but I would recommend starting with your normal rate. And then if someone asks you for a discount, you can work something fair out with them.

4. Sell your stuff on Facebook Marketplace

It’s amazing what people will pay for second-hand items that are cluttering up your house. You can even look for free stuff that people are looking to donate and resell it. Boom. Free money!

I sold a lot of stuff on Facebook marketplace. I would take great, well-light pictures and then price everything about 20% higher than I wanted to get. People will ALWAYS ask you down, so make sure you price things a little higher than you want so that you leave enough room for them to comfortably negotiate with you.

I would also note on every post:

  • Porch pick up only
  • No holds
  • First come first serve
  • Venmo, Zelle or cash (or whatever cash apps you prefer)
  • If the listing is still up, then the item is still available

First of all, I’m not trying to see anybody. I’m in my PJs all day long and don’t want to put clothes on just because someone wants to buy my old baby bottle dryer. That’s why I said porch PU only.

Second, I would have people ask me to hold the item and then ghost me. So I’d be thinking someone was coming at 5pm and then they’d never show up, and I’d have already turned away 3 other people that wanted to buy it.

Finally, putting the payment methods that you take on your listing will cut out a lot of unnecessary messages from people.

10. Deliver Groceries with Walmart’s Spark Delivery

This is a great way to earn money if you’re comfortable driving around town. Sign up with Walmart’s Spark delivery service and start delivering groceries to people’s homes.

You can set your own schedule and you don’t have to worry about dealing with traffic or parking. Plus, you get to help people out by providing them with their groceries in a timely manner.

I like this options better than Instacart because you don’t have actually have to shop for the groceries. Just drive up and they’ll load you up with orders to deliver. I believe they pay $7 per delivery, plus the customers almost always tip you.

I’ve had friends that work only in the mornings and make an easy $100/day for 4 hours of work. Just remember that you have to subtract your gas money.

You can take passengers with you as long as they’re not little kids that can’t stay in the car by themselves. You’ll have to take the groceries up to the customer’s door, so your kids need to be old enough to stay in the car by themselves.

14. Donate Plasma

Donating plasma is a great way to earn money if you’re in need of some extra cash. Plasma centers usually pay you up to $50 per donation. I’ve even seen some places offer coupons for as much as $800 for a series of donations. 

The process is relatively simple and doesn’t take long – usually about an hour or so. You just need to meet some requirements and fill out some paperwork before you can donate. The center will also perform a few tests to make sure that your plasma is safe for use.

Donating plasma is a great way to help other people while also making some money. Plus, you get free snacks and drinks while you’re there! You can watch videos to take your mind off of what you’re doing.
